The final price for impact windows depends on several variables. The biggest factor is the size and type of your window frames, along with the specific glass thickness required for your local building codes. Opting for custom shapes or specialized tints also shifts the total. While no glass is truly indestructible, impact proof windows are manufactured to resist penetration from flying debris. They provide peace of mind by maintaining the building envelope during extreme weather events. You need these if you are looking for a permanent upgrade that eliminates the need for plywood or metal shutters. Summer heat puts a massive strain on air conditioning systems. Impact windows help manage indoor temperatures by blocking out intense solar heat, which means your cooling system does not have to work nearly as hard. This efficiency is a huge benefit during the hottest months, helping you maintain a cool home without excessive energy waste.
